Kuo: Apple Watch Series 8 may include new temperature sensors, plus new AirPods rumors
- The Apple Watch Series 8 will reportedly feature body temperature sensors.
- New AirPods will also reportedly feature new health-tracking capabilities.
He stated that he is optimistic about the demand for the 2022 Apple Watch because of its new health features. These features will reportedly include temperature sensors, enabling users to check if they have a fever or cold at any time. Mark Gurman of Bloomberg previously predicted these temperature sensors, and The Wall Street Journal stated that they would help with fertility planning.
In recent years, Apple has added many more health tracking features to the Apple Watch, including heart rate tracking, an ECG app, blood oxygen measuring, fall detection, and much more. The addition of body temperature sensors is the logical next step in making the Apple Watch the "future of health."As for future AirPods, Kuo says they will include health tracking features but did not specify exactly what these features will be. In 2020, DigiTimes reported that a future version of AirPods would feature advanced health tracking capabilities that would enable them to track and monitor users' heart rate, step count, and health conditions. These could be the features that Kuo is talking about.
According to Kuo, Chinese supplier Luxshare Precision will be the "largest beneficiary" of these new health-tracking products.
